Ticket: Config drift on Nimbara cache tier. Postmortem for the stale-cache incident found staging and prod disagreed on TTL and invalidation fan-out; plugins tested against staging saw fresh data, prod served stale. Drift originated from a manual hotfix never backported. Plugin authors: validate against the canonical values, not whatever your sandbox happens to have. Drift checks now run hourly. The canonical config the checker enforces is pasted below.

settings of kagag-kagef:
[kelath]
port = 9300
region = west-4
host = kelath.olvarqworks.example
team = sorion
timeout_ms = 1000
retries = 8

**Vendor note: Inkmill markdown pipeline**

Rendering for Parchway docs is outsourced to Inkmill under an annual contract, renewing each March. They handle sanitization and PDF export; we own the upload queue. SLA: 4-hour response on rendering failures. Escalate only after two failed retries. Their support desk is reachable at the address below.

billing contact of hahaf-baguf = zorael.tammir.jorius@sivrelhq.internal

**Q: Why does the Murrow Hall audio-guide app sometimes play the wrong exhibit track?** Short version: the beacon map in the Loden app caches stale room assignments after gallery reshuffles. Curators move exhibits, nobody bumps the map version, and visitors hear a lecture about tapestries while staring at pottery. Fix is in flight — we're adding a version check on launch. Until then, force-refresh clears it. Full details and the curator update workflow are on the page below.

operations page: https://confluence.qorvellabs.internal/pages/projects/projects/projects